Established in 1884, the Devenish Railway Hotel is a historic double-brick country pub that has been lovingly restored over 19 years. It features a U-shaped timber bar with exposed red bricks and an open fireplace,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. Adjacent to the bar is a café nook serving espresso coffee and baked delights to travelers and locals. The hotel also boasts a light-filled dining lounge with exposed brick walls, a four-seat intimate nook, and a ten-seat private dining room. Operating six days a week, it serves the local community and visitors exploring the Silo Art Trail. The expansive grounds offer potential for accommodation development, including cabins or RV parking, subject to council approval.
